For refusal of the contractor to replace the expired Bank guarantee it is possible to collect the penalty

1 November 2019, Friday

The company has overdue delivery of works under the contract. By that time, the Bank guarantee that ensured the execution of the contract had expired. For failure to provide new security, the customer demanded a penalty, the court supported him. The delay in performance of works arose due to the fault of the contractor. Under the terms of the contract, he had to replace the collateral within 10 working days.

Recall, from July 1, the contract should be a condition to replace the Bank guarantee, if the Bank revoked the license. The obligation arises after the customer has notified the supplier of the need to provide security. The replacement is given a month from the date of notification. For non-compliance with the deadline, penalties are charged as for late performance of obligations.

Document: Resolution of the Arbitration court of the North-Western district of 24.09.2019 in the case N A56-141584/2018
